Power manipulator, also known as manipulator, balance crane, balance booster, manual transfer machine (the above statement is not professional, but has been popular in China), is a novel power assisted equipment for material handling and installation. It skillfully applies the balance principle of force, so that the operator can push and pull the weight correspondingly, and then the balance, movement and positioning can be achieved in the space. When the weight is lifted or lowered, it forms a floating state, and zero operating force is guaranteed by the air circuit (in fact, because of the control of processing technology and design cost, the operating force is less than 3kg). The operating force is affected by the weight of the workpiece. Without skilled inching operation, the operator can push and pull the heavy object by hand, and can put the weight in any position in the space correctly.
Due to the characteristics of gravity free, accurate and intuitive, convenient operation, high effect and safety, the "balance crane" is widely used in modern industrial occasions such as material transfer, high frequency handling, accurate positioning and component assembly.
